A central air conditioning conditioner cools air in one spot prior to dispersing it throughout the residence utilizing the heater’s air handling abilities. This sets it apart from window or wall a/c or mini-split systems, which all chill fairly tiny locations and require numerous systems to cool the whole house.
The majority of single-family homes in the United States with central air use a split system. This implies that the gadget is divided into two parts: an evaporator coil within house and a compressor exterior.

Your specialist will help you in figuring out the appropriate size central air conditioner for your home. A unit that is too little will run virtually continuously, whereas a system that is too big will chill the house too rapidly and turn off before completing a complete cycle.
The quick on/off in the latter circumstance is taxing on the system. It can trigger the evaporator coil to freeze, and a frozen coil prevents air from streaming. As a result, a huge air conditioning unit may be less efficient at cooling than a smaller sized unit.
Your Air Conditioner installation will do a estimation called a “Manual-J” to determine best system for your home. This will consider all of the parameters we’ve discussed and more, leading to the most precise size possible.
Nevertheless, we understand that numerous property owners like to have a general notion of what size they require ahead of time. central air conditioning conditioner size: To get the Btu essential, multiply the square footage of your house’s conditioned area by 25, then divide by 12,000 to get the tonnage.
Keep in mind that this is simply a standard quote, and there are numerous aspects. If your home’s first flooring has 12-foot ceilings, the air conditioner will have more air to chill.

Costs differ based upon the regional market and the task information, just like any considerable job. For labor and products, a normal split system central air conditioning installation utilizing an existing heating system could cost between $3,000 and $7,000 or more. Usually, that expense will be divided around 60/40, with labor accounting for bulk of it.
